
Pueblo Tribal Council
The Pueblo Tribal Council is a governing body that represents the interests of the Pueblo community, a Native American group. It is responsible for making decisions on local laws, policies, and programs that affect tribal members. The council is typically composed of elected representatives who work to ensure the preservation of cultural heritage, promote economic development, and manage resources. It operates within the framework of tribal sovereignty, meaning it has the authority to self-govern and make decisions independently in accordance with tribal traditions and federal laws.
